| An electromagnetically inductive heating method features that the three-phase magnetic conductor composed of magnetic steel and iron core forms a closed three-phase magnetic loop. When three-phase main-frequency power supply is connected to three-phase windings surrounding the iron core, the magnetic steel is quickly heated by eddy current and magnetic lag generated by three-phase alternative magnetic flux in it, that is, electric energy is directly converted into magnetothermal energy. Its advantages are simple strucutre, load balance for three phases and high thermal efficiency. | |||
